[Experimental tyrosine keratopathy in rabbits]
Summary
Tyrosine administration caused corneal lesions in rabbits, including epithelial cell necrosis, despite apparent clinical recovery. These findings highlight potential long-term effects of tyrosine on corneal health.

Purpose:
- To evaluate the impact of tyrosine administration on the corneal epithelium and endothelium.
- To characterize the histological and ultrastructural changes in the cornea following tyrosine exposure.
Summary:
- Administration of tyrosine to rabbits induced pinpoint lesions and pseudokeratitis dendritica in the corneal epithelium within days.
- While clinical signs resolved, scanning electron microscopy confirmed persistent epithelial cell necrosis for over 20 days.
- Light microscopy revealed epithelial cell proliferation and vacuolization, with potential endothelial defects leading to stromal edema.
